* {font-size:12px;font-family:arial, sans-serif;color:#515151;}
body
{
margin: 0;
padding: 0;
width:100%;
height:100%;
} 
#site{
width: 1100px;
height: 990px;
border: none;
margin: 30px auto;
display:block;
background-image:url(../img/background.jpg);
}
.header{
  width:100%;
  height:188px;
  border:none;
  display:block;
  }
.language{
    position:relative;
    left:840px;
    top:5px;
    width:180px;
    height:20px;
    display:block;
  }
.content{position:relative;
  top:40px;
  left:35px;
  width:970px;}
.footer{
  position:relative ;
  bottom:-120px;
  left:35px;
  
  }

a.top_navi_links:link{
  font-size:12px;
  font-family:arial, sans-serif;
  color:#969696;
  text-decoration:none;
  margin-right:15px;
  font-weight:normal;}
a.top_navi_links:visited{
  font-size:12px;
  font-family:arial, sans-serif;
  color:#969696;
  text-decoration:none;
  margin-right:15px;
  font-weight:normal;}
a.top_navi_links:hover{
  font-size:12px;
  font-family:arial, sans-serif;
  color:#af1e46;
  text-decoration:none;
  margin-right:15px;
  font-weight:normal;}
  
a.top_navi_links_active:link{
  font-size:12px;
  font-family:arial, sans-serif;
  color:#af1e46;
  text-decoration:none;
  margin-right:15px;
  font-weight:normal;}
a.top_navi_links_active:visited{
  font-size:12px;
  font-family:arial, sans-serif;
  color:#af1e46;
  text-decoration:none;
  margin-right:15px;
  font-weight:normal;}
a.top_navi_links_active:hover{
  font-size:12px;
  font-family:arial, sans-serif;
  color:#af1e46;
  text-decoration:none;
  margin-right:15px;
  font-weight:normal;}
     
.headline {font-size:22px; font-weight:bold; font-family:arial,sans-serif;}
.werke_headline {font-size:12px; font-weight:bold; font-family:arial,sans-serif; color:#515151;}  
.werke{position:relative;text-align:left;font-size:10px;top:300px;margin-left:15px; margin-right:auto; width:150px;vertical-align:bottom;color:#515151;border:none;float:right}

.kontakthinweis {color:red; font-size:14px; font-weight:bold;}
.clear{clear:both;}
.lclear{clear:left;}
.rclear{clear:right;}